36 with jowls and smile lines, I don’t want fillers- is a facelift my only option? (Photos)

fiifiitrixie
I’m 36 years old and very unhappy with the way my lower face has aged; what feels like prematurely. I want to remove the lines around my mouth as best as possible; as well as give my lower face some lift. I told myself I would wait until I was 40 to have a facelift of any kind; but now I’m wondering if I can wait that long or if it would be better to act preventatively. Is microneedling (not rf- don’t think I can afford to lose any volume) enough to hold me over for a few years and treat the lines effectively? Is it better to act preventatively and fer a facelift sooner rather than later? How many facelifts can one hsve in a lifetime? I don’t want to use fillers- what are the best options for me to achieve my goals ?
